Donna Ferrato: 'I saw that he was getting ready to hit her and I took the picture'
I try to get into real people's lives and tell their stories. I was photographing a couple for some time. I was in their home, sleeping, when I heard the woman screaming. It was 2 a.m. and I could hear things crashing and breaking in the bathroom. I was scared because I knew the husband had a gun. I took my camera and went running down the hall. When I walked into the bathroom, I saw that he was going to hit her and I took the picture. His hand was in the air and I was shocked. That was the first time I saw him commit an act of violence, and my instinct was to take the picture first.
But after I got the picture, I didn't just keep shooting. When I saw his hand go back to hit her a second time, I grabbed his arm and said, "What the hell are you doing? You're going to hurt her!" He said, "She's my wife and I have to teach her a lesson", but he didn't hit her again.
When I was taking other photographs for I Am Unbeatable, my book on domestic violence, I was always divided: What is more important, to take a picture or defend the victim? If I chose to put down my camera and stop one man from hitting one woman, I'd be helping just one woman. However, if I got the picture, I could help countless more.

Observacions i context
- Se puede trabajar junto con las actividades “To help or not to help” y “How many Pulitzers do you have?” en varias sesiones y reflexionar en las consecuencias beneficiosas o perjudiciales, de la intervención de las personas que fotografían conflictos.
- Distribuir al alumnado preferiblemente en grupos heterogéneos para que todo el mundo pueda participar según su nivel, ya que algunas preguntas son más sencillas y otras más difíciles.
- Se necesitará ordenador, proyector y altavoces para el vídeo, así como una cuenta de Vimeo (gratuita).
- Otras mujeres contemporáneas o de características similares: April Saul, Mary Ellen Mark o Lynn Johnson.

Descripció
Actividad de comprensión lectora: el alumnado lee el texto extraído y adaptado de un artículo de The Guardian, identifica la información requerida (general y esencial), reflexiona sobre aspectos socioculturales (violencia de género) y cómo son representadas a través del arte y la cultura, y responde a las preguntas.
